description Product Description

Used extensively in water purification systems to remove impurities and ions, ensuring safe and clean drinking water.

Applied in the pharmaceutical industry for the purification and separation of active ingredients, enhancing drug quality and efficacy.

Employed in chemical processing to recover valuable metals and separate different chemical compounds, improving process efficiency.

Utilized in the food and beverage sector to remove unwanted ions and improve product taste and stability.

Integrated into wastewater treatment plants to treat industrial effluents, reducing environmental pollution.

Applied in research laboratories for chromatography and other analytical techniques, aiding in precise chemical analysis.
